diff --git a/.emacs.d/lisp/init-evil.el b/.emacs.d/lisp/init-evil.el index 91a94fe9..e0326fc9 100644 --- a/.emacs.d/lisp/init-evil.el +++ b/.emacs.d/lisp/init-evil.el @@ -113,6 +113,9 @@ (with-eval-after-load 'helm (define-key evil-motion-state-map "'" 'helm-all-mark-rings) (global-set-key (kbd "M-y") 'helm-show-kill-ring) + ;; Since Helm 3.6.* M-SPC is bound to helm-toggle-visible-mark-backward by default. + (define-key helm-map (kbd "M-SPC") 'helm-toggle-visible-mark) + (define-key helm-map (kbd "M-S-SPC") 'helm-toggle-visible-mark-backward) (dolist (map (list helm-find-files-map helm-read-file-map)) (ambrevar/define-keys map "M-." 'helm-end-of-buffer